Insider tip — Huashan Hot Springs are set at the eastern foot of Mount Hua (Huashan), one of China's Five Sacred Mountains, where silica-rich thermal water emerges from the ancient granite massif at around 45°C. Soaking after the famously vertiginous plank-walk ascent of Huashan's sheer quartzite cliffs is a reward that perfectly matches the mountain's legendary difficulty. Early evening is ideal, when returning pilgrims and hikers fill the outdoor pools and the floodlit cliffs glow above the valley.
